Linux系统的关闭防火墙

1. 关闭防火墙前的准备

在关闭Linux系统的防火墙之前,我们需要进行一些准备工作,以确保系统的安全性和稳定性。

1.1 检查防火墙状态

首先,我们需要检查当前系统的防火墙状态,可以使用以下命令:

sudo systemctl status firewalld

如果返回的结果中包含"active (running)"的字样,说明防火墙当前处于运行状态。

此时,您可以考虑是否需要关闭防火墙,以便在特定情况下提高网络连接的速度和灵活性。

1.2 确定关闭防火墙的必要性

在决定关闭防火墙之前,您需要明确关闭防火墙的原因和影响。关闭防火墙可能会增加系统遭受恶意攻击的风险,因此请确保在安全的网络环境下进行操作。

例如,如果您在受控且受保护的网络内进行开发或测试工作,可能不需要使用防火墙。但在生产环境或连接到不可信网络的情况下,关闭防火墙可能会导致系统容易受到攻击。

1.3 创建系统快照

在关闭防火墙之前,建议您创建系统的快照或备份。这样,在关闭防火墙引起问题时,您可以轻松地还原系统。

根据您使用的系统和工具,可以使用不同的方法创建系统快照。

2. 关闭防火墙

一旦您完成了前面的准备工作并决定关闭防火墙,您可以按照以下步骤完成关闭过程。

2.1 停止防火墙服务

首先,您需要停止当前运行的防火墙服务。根据您使用的Linux发行版,可以选择不同的命令。

如果您使用的是CentOS或Red Hat Enterprise Linux(RHEL),可以使用以下命令停止firewalld服务:

sudo systemctl stop firewalld

如果您使用的是Ubuntu或Debian,可以使用以下命令停止UFW服务:

sudo ufw disable

2.2 关闭防火墙开机自启动

以下步骤将确保在系统重启后,防火墙服务不会自动启动。

2.2.1 CentOS和RHEL

如果您使用的是CentOS或RHEL,可以按照以下步骤关闭firewalld服务的开机自启动:

sudo systemctl disable firewalld

2.2.2 Ubuntu和Debian

如果您使用的是Ubuntu或Debian,可以按照以下步骤关闭UFW服务的开机自启动:

sudo systemctl disable ufw

2.3 检查防火墙状态

为了确认防火墙已成功关闭,您可以再次使用以下命令检查防火墙状态:

sudo systemctl status firewalld

sudo ufw status

3. 其他注意事项

关闭防火墙后,您需要额外注意以下几点:

3.1 安全性考虑

请记住,关闭防火墙可能会增加系统遭受网络攻击的风险,因此请在确保网络环境安全的情况下进行操作。定期进行系统安全性评估和漏洞扫描是很重要的。

3.2 临时关闭防火墙

如果您只需要临时关闭防火墙,可以使用以下命令:

sudo systemctl stop firewalld

sudo ufw disable

但请注意,这将只在当前会话中停止防火墙服务,重启后仍会自动启动。

3.3 启用防火墙

如果您决定重新启用防火墙,可以使用以下命令启动防火墙服务:

sudo systemctl start firewalld

sudo ufw enable

请根据实际需求来决定是否关闭或启用防火墙,并合理权衡安全性和灵活性之间的关系。

操作系统标签